Blockchain is not a proof of idea; it’s going to turn out to be a monetary infrastructure in 2025. Within the third quarter, legacy establishments quietly crossed the road from testing to constructing.
A brand new report reveals that banks, fee networks and cloud suppliers – from SWIFT to Google Cloud and Visa – at the moment are utilizing blockchain extensively – reshaping the best way world finance strikes, settles and shops worth.
The third quarter of 2025 can be a turning level for world blockchain integration
Messari Q3 2025’s Crypto x TradFi Group Report highlighted how the quarter turned a defining second within the integration of conventional finance and crypto. Massive enterprises started utilizing blockchain to streamline their operations, scale back transaction prices and strengthen their market place.
For instance, JPMorgan’s Kinexys community now processes greater than $2 billion in every day transactions and has cleared greater than $1.5 trillion since launch. Within the third quarter, blockchain continued to broaden into carbon markets, provide chain finance and cross-border settlements. Based on Messari analysts, this transfer indicated:
“The financial institution’s intention to make blockchain infrastructure a regular a part of institutional settlement.”
In the meantime, SWIFT is creating a shared real-time ledger that connects greater than 30 world banks. The community will operate in parallel with SWIFT’s previous messaging system.
Along with banking infrastructure, stablecoin-focused initiatives additionally gained momentum within the third quarter. In August, Circle launched Arc, a brand new Layer-1 blockchain constructed particularly for stablecoin financing.
Equally, Stripe and Paradigm unveiled Tempo, a payments-based Layer-1 blockchain constructed particularly for stablecoin transactions. Advisory companions embody Deutsche Financial institution, Visa, Shopify, Revolut, OpenAI and Customary Chartered.
In the meantime, Visa has rolled out a pilot program that enables choose companions to pre-fund accounts with stablecoins to speed up cross-border payouts. A wider launch is deliberate for 2026.
Lastly, Customary Chartered’s Anchorpoint three way partnership has utilized for a stablecoin issuance license underneath Hong Kong’s new regulatory regime.
“Anchorpoint’s early adoption positions Customary Chartered as one of many first multinational banks to pursue direct issuance of stablecoins,” Messari famous.
Tech firms are becoming a member of the Blockchain infrastructure race
As banks and funds firms constructed transaction rails, tech giants constructed the infrastructure to host them within the third quarter. In August, Google Cloud launched the Common Ledger (GCUL).
It’s a impartial Layer-1 blockchain designed for banks and capital markets. Early accomplice CME Group is already testing GCUL for quicker collateral settlement and margin optimization.
“GCUL leverages years of Google analysis into distributed methods to supply a impartial settlement community that helps a number of belongings, contains built-in compliance and operates 24/7,” the report highlights.
Moreover, Cloudflare introduced plans for NET Greenback final month. Not like typical stablecoins, NET Greenback is targeted on machine-to-machine and AI-driven transactions. These initiatives spotlight the size of blockchain adoption up to now quarter.
“Corporations are not experimenting with blockchain; they’re constructing their very own chains. The query shouldn’t be whether or not establishments will use blockchain infrastructure, however quite how far they are going to go and the way shortly they are going to get there,” stated Messari’s analysis analyst Youssef.
Analysis by a16z Crypto confirms this adoption. Corporations like Citigroup, Mastercard and Visa at the moment are providing or creating blockchain-driven merchandise for patrons.
Establishments are additionally growing their publicity to digital belongings. The EY Institutional Investor Digital Property Survey 2025 reveals that 86% of establishments now personal or plan to carry digital belongings, with 59% in search of allocations of greater than 5% of belongings underneath administration.
Particularly, larger regulatory readability is accelerating this shift. Banks, fintechs, establishments and regulators at the moment are lining as much as combine blockchain into core monetary infrastructure, turning what had been as soon as experiments into the brand new customary for world finance.
